HRC 49: Interactive dialogue with the Special Representative of the Secretary General on Children and armed conflict, Ms. Virginia Gamba

Delivered by Mrs. Zoya Stepanyan, First Secretary

 

Mr. President,

Armenia welcomes the Special Representative and thanks for her continued engagement with the Council. We warmly congratulate Madam Gamba on the occasion of 25th anniversary of the creation of the mandate.

Neither global health care crises, nor the calls of the Secretary General for the global ceasefire stopped aggressive militarism and the victimization of the most vulnerable.

As the world gradually recovers from the pandemic, another humanitarian disaster is unfolding in our region. 15 months after secession of active hostilities Azerbaijan has blown up gas pipeline in Nagorno-Karabakh exercising a collective punishment and imposing unbearable living conditions upon its indigenous people. Children in Nagorno-Karabakh are freezing in this winter conditions just for having Armenian ethnic origin. Continued shelling of vilages and specifically schools is accompanied by the non stop threats from loudspeakers to terrorize the civilians.  In the absence of voices in defense of their rights, this evil roar is all that the children in Artsakh hear.

Azerbaijan is apparently inspired by impunity it enjoyed for committing war crimes during its aggression against Nagorno-Karabakh, when again the first victims were children, who were killed by brutal and indiscriminate bombardments including by cluster munition and incendiary weapons.   

I thank you.

 

Right of Reply

 

President,

Armenia exercises its right of reply to Azerbaijan.

During the previous, 48th Session of this Council we warned about racism and hate speech in Azerbaijan. Armenia stated on the record that high ranking Azerbaijani officials were posting photos of Stepanakert, capital of Nagorno-Karabakh, deprived of electricity and water and calling it (I quote) “an Armenian reservation, which will submit to Azerbaijan or will flee” (end of the quote). They were threatening the people of Nagorno-Karabakh with cold winters without electricity and water. Back in October the Permanent Mission of Azerbaijan denied those statements. However, at this very moment we witness how those calls have materialized. It has been more than a week now since Azerbaijan cut the energy supply to Nagorno-Karabakh. 

The news agencies were showing earlier today the children hospital in Stepanakert where the patients were literally freezing in the cold winter conditions. Children cannot attend schools because there is no heating. Furthermore, Azerbaijan keeps under fire the Armenian villages in vicinity to the line of contact.

Meanwhile, Azerbaijan uses loudspeakers to intimidate civilians and call them to leave Nagorno-Karabakh, otherwise threatening to use force against them. Some villages have already evacuated their children and elderly, which came to add to another 40.000 Armenians who were displaced by the recent war. The displaced people are double victimized since many of them do not have yet adequate housing and living conditions.     

There are many shocking images coming from Nagorno-Karabakh. Instead of exercising the right of reply under this agenda item we could have just shared those photos and videos to this august Council. 

After three consecutive wars imposed upon people of Nagorno Karabakh in the course of 30 years and after decades of a foreign domination marked by ethnic cleansing and massacres, Azerbaijan now explores new methods of terror.

Certainly, Azerbaijan takes advantage of the disarray the world found itself to finalize its long-term plan of ethnic cleansing of the Armenian population of Nagorno Karabakh. It also takes advantage of the near absence of international organizations in Nagorno-Karabakh. For many years Azerbaijan has hindered the access of international organizations to Nagorno-Karabakh to carry out its heinous plans without any foreign scrutiny. 

However, we believe that in no circumstances the international community should give a blank license to Azerbaijan to pursue its ethnic cleansing campaign.

I thank you.
